Blackstone Steak Fajitas

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 ½ pounds flank steak (or steak of your choice)
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il (divided)
  • 1 red bell pepper (sliced)
  • 1 yellow bell pepper (sliced)
  • 1 red onion (sliced)
  • 3 cloves garlic (minced)
  • 2 tablespoons vegetable oil (for grilling)
  • Tortillas (flour or corn, for serving)
  • 1 teaspoon chili powder
  • 1 teaspoon cumin
  • ½ teaspoon smoked paprika
  • ½ teaspoon kosher salt
  • ¼ teaspoon ground black pepper

Instructions

  1. In a small bowl, mix chili powder, cumin, smoked paprika, kosher salt, and black pepper.
  2. Slice the flank steak against the grain into thin strips and marinate with 1 tablespoon olive oil and half of the spice mix.
  3. In another bowl, combine sliced bell peppers and onion with remaining olive oil and spice mix.
  4. Preheat your Blackstone griddle over medium-high heat for about 5 minutes; add vegetable oil once hot.
  5. Spread marinated steak and vegetables in a single layer on the griddle. Sear undisturbed for 3-4 minutes.
  6. Stir gently and cook for an additional 4-6 minutes until cooked through; add minced garlic during the last few minutes.
  7. Warm tortillas on the griddle briefly before assembling fajitas with beef and veggies.
